Overview Are you a visionary leader with a passion for innovation and a strong technical background? Join our team as the
Director of Engineering
and play a pivotal role in shaping the future of our property. As the Director of Engineering, you will oversee a dynamic team and be responsible for the strategic planning, implementation, and management of all engineering operations for our properties on Mackinac Island to ensure seamless operations and a superior guest experience. If you thrive in a fast-paced environment, have a knack for problem-solving, and possess excellent leadership skills, this is the perfect opportunity for you to make a lasting impact in the hospitality industry.
Responsibilities
Develop and execute strategic plans to optimize engineering operations and enhance overall efficiency.
Oversee the maintenance, repair, and renovation of the property's infrastructure and systems.
Manage the engineering team, providing guidance, training, and mentorship to drive excellence.
Collaborate with other departments to ensure seamless integration of engineering services.
Implement sustainable and eco-friendly initiatives to promote energy conservation.
Monitor and analyze key performance indicators to drive continuous improvement.
Ensure compliance with safety and regulatory standards.
Foster a culture of innovation, teamwork, and exceptional service delivery.
Qualifications
Previous experience as a Director or Assistant Director required
Hotel, institutional, HVAC systems experience of 3-5 years
Refrigeration, HVAC certification
Working knowledge of electrical, mechanical, life safety systems, preventative maintenance systems, etc.
Budget management, cost control and financial responsibility experience with stationary engineering licensed preferred. Valid driver’s license.
Ability to communicate effectively with the public and other team members
Benefits Davidson Hospitality Group is an award-winning, full-service hospitality management company overseeing hotels, restaurants, dining and entertainment venues across the US. A trusted partner and preferred operator for Hilton, Hyatt, Kimpton, Marriott, and Margaritaville, Davidson offers a unique entrepreneurial management style and owners’ mentality that provides the individualized personal service of a small company, enhanced by the breadth and depth of skill and experience of a larger company. In keeping with the company’s heritage of delivering value, Davidson is comprised of four highly specialized operating verticals: Davidson Hotels, Pivot, Davidson Resorts and Davidson Restaurant Group.
